I have a smok micro one and I seem to be burning through coils in about 4 days they only taste good for about 2! I have tried the .25 and .3. When I use the .3 I burn at about 36 watts at the soft setting using Vaporfi liquid max vg [yes I know the more vg the faster your coils burn] but 4 days? When I use .25 I use the temp control at about 220 with the tcr set at 105 and have tried just about every setting imaginable to no avail. I use about one 3.5 ml tank a day BTW. If someone could please help I'd appreciate it as I am very new to this only about 3 months in. But I do prefer the vape to lung method and 18 to 24 MG nicotine level solutions.

I am not an expert, but have you tried to make your own coils? it's really fun all you need is an rebuildable tank atomizer and look some YouTube videos, this is what I do, I make one coil until I get the resistance I want, 1.5 ohms and pay attention how many wraps and then I just make 4 or 5 more coils, one coil last me about 2, 3 weeks, I could just change the cotton wick and keep going but once you make your first coil is game on
